Reactive UI - Unreal Engine - VS2022 (UETKX)

Editor support for .uetkx, the JSX-like markup of Reactive UI Toolkit for Unreal — a React-style reactive UI library for Unreal Engine 5.6+, in pure C++.

Features

  • Syntax highlighting for the JSX-like markup and the embedded C++, via a self-contained TextMate grammar.
  • Markup IntelliSense — completion and hover for host-element tags, structural/common attributes, style/slot keys, and per-element event handlers, driven by the compiler-exported schema.
  • Import intelligence — specifier and exported-name completions, go-to-definition across .uetkx files, and strict resolution diagnostics.
  • Diagnostics — live parse diagnostics plus the compiler's own diagnostics surfaced from committed sidecars — fully offline, no running Unreal editor required.
  • Formatting — canonical .uetkx formatting (golden-corpus locked to the C++ compiler), with an optional Format on Save (Tools ▸ Options ▸ Reactive UI Toolkit ▸ UETKX).

Requirements

  • Everything is bundled — the language server ships with the extension (a Node runtime is included), so no Node on your PATH and no running Unreal editor are required.
  • clangd 22.1.6 is bundled too (Apache-2.0 w/ LLVM exceptions): embedded C++ intelligence inside component/hook/util bodies and value initializers works with zero machine setup once your project has a compile database (UBT -mode=GenerateClangDatabase or the VS Code generator).

Changelog

[0.9.1] - 2026-07-31

  • Embedded-C++ false-positive suppression on UE-interop .uetkx files (TB-31): the embedded clangd view cannot reliably parse the heaviest UE headers from scratch (the real build gets them pre-compiled in the SharedPCH), so ERROR diagnostics rooted in an #included file or a template instantiation now mark the virtual TU as compromised and the whole cascade is dropped, as are clang's overload-resolution false-positives on the heavily-templated hook/API surface and undeclared identifier errors naming cross-file imports (the virtual TU cannot see other files' exports — a real unimported name still gets UETKX2305). Genuine local typos and syntax errors still surface; RuitkCompile and the C++ build remain the authoritative error source.

[0.9.0] - 2026-07-28

  • Family rebrand to Reactive UI Toolkit (repo ruitk-unreal): every embedded-C++ and scaffold identifier follows the plugin's 0.15.0 renames — FRuitk*/URuitk* types, the Ruitk:: namespace, RUITK_* macros, Ruitk* modules — across the grammar, completions, hovers, diagnostics, quick-fixes, and the synthetic virtual document. Pair with plugin 0.15.0 (see MIGRATION-0.15.md and -run=RuitkMigrateBrand).
  • Quick-fix and documentation texts now reference the renamed commandlets (-run=RuitkCompile / RuitkExportSchema).
  • Marketplace identity and display names are unchanged; the umbrella-name search keywords (reactive ui toolkit, ruitk) are added alongside the existing ones.
  • License reference updated to LicenseRef-Reactive-UI-Toolkit-Community-1.1 — the retitled Reactive UI Toolkit Community License 1.1 (terms unchanged).

[0.8.0] - 2026-07-25

  • Live attribute-VALUE validation (UETKX2311): enum vocabularies (incl. style/slot keys), float/int/bool formats, and margin arity check as-you-type, with enum value completion inside the quotes; expr-only string forms surface live.
  • Malformed style/slot value strings, flag-form misuse, string/flag props on typed component params, and Ref without {expr} all diagnose live (2311/0105); the schema now carries attrKinds.
  • Live 0109/0110/0111 mirrors (duplicate attributes, duplicate sibling keys, parent-ignored slot keys — parent-tracked incl. directive bodies), UETKX2312 event-payload misuse (void/mismatched/silently-empty reads), and UETKX2313 sinceUE-vs-EngineAssociation gating.
  • Brush-name validation live (2311 + did-you-mean against the engine's resolvable style set) and value-completion parity: FCoreStyle brush names inside BorderImage="", true/false for bool-kind values.
  • Instant 2310 for butchered ctor-style declarations (the DoomFace blind spot) with a looser did-you-mean threshold; UETKX0112 canonical-casing mirror; attr-name completion fixed to whole-token replacement (no more slot.Clipping hybrids; the Slot. prefix narrows to slot keys).
  • Completion/diagnostic parity: slot-key suggestions filter by the parent's consumption map (labeled "read by "), and already-present attrs or sinceUE-gated tags are never offered — accepting a suggestion can no longer produce an immediate error.
  • Live UETKX2305 strict-usage mirror: a usage whose name a workspace file exports but this file never imports errors as-you-type with the add-import quick-fix (kind-matched, sidecar-deduped); 2310 near-miss candidates extend to import names and same-file declarations.
  • FILE_SCOPED_EXPORTS mirrors: same-name export pairs across files publish zero diagnostics (the live 2106 mirror is retired); 2305 add-import suggestions and go-to-exporter pick the importer-NEAREST exporter exactly like the compiler; the rename refusal for names exported elsewhere is retired.
  • Watched-files revalidation: the client watches **/*.uetkx, so deleting or renaming a file ON DISK re-flags open importers immediately — previously nothing updated until a keystroke in the importer.
  • Live component-TAG policing: an unimported tag errors as-you-type (2305 with the add-import quick-fix, importer-nearest exporter) and an unknown tag gets 2307 — previously tags were only checked via the hash-gated compiler sidecar, so the squiggle flickered with every edit.
  • Import-specifier DX: single-quoted specifiers color and get full tooling in both quote styles (the formatter still canonicalizes to double quotes on save); specifier completions order nearest-first; accepting a suggestion REPLACES the typed prefix instead of appending.
  • Embedded-C++ scaffold returns FRuiNode: clangd no longer flags every early return — element or fragment — with "void function should not return a value"; return null; neutralizes typed. The fragment delimiters <> and </> now color as tag punctuation like element brackets.
  • return null; is first-class in the editor: both bare and parenthesized forms scan clean as render-nothing returns (early guards and null-only components), satisfy the component-return requirement, terminate unreachable-code dimming, and format canonically to the bare form.

[0.7.0] - 2026-07-18

  • ES combined import forms land in the editor: import Def, { a, b as c } from "./file" and import Def, * as X from "./file" parse, color (grammar + combined-aware highlighting), format (one canonical line — the reprint previously would have dropped the named part), navigate, and complete like every other import head. Every editor consumer treats the default/named/star parts independently: the reference index, find-all-references/rename, the virtual-doc C++ intelligence (all parts declare their surfaces to clangd), tag completion, and the unused-import quickfix — which now removes only the unused PART of a combined line instead of the whole statement.
  • Completion inside import braces got smarter: Ctrl+Space in import Def, {} from "./file" works (the combined form classifies like any name list), and suggestions now exclude bindings the statement already carries — the names/aliases already listed in the braces, plus (for a combined line) the default alias and the member the default export already binds.
  • Semantic tokens land: imported binding names now color by the KIND of the export they bind — components as types, hooks and utils as functions, values as variables, * as X aliases as namespaces (they are spelled X::Member), and a default alias by its target's export default kind. The tokens override the grammar's uniform type tint in every LSP client and degrade silently when a target does not resolve.
  • UETKX2304 (unused import) now surfaces as an ERROR (breaking, family-wide owner decision — the compiler promoted it to match the other import diagnostics, and the sidecar relay carries the new severity into the editor). The squiggle spans the whole binding token, and a renamed entry ({ A as B }) anchors its LOCAL alias — the token you would delete. Safe from false positives: the compiler's reference scan over-approximates "used" (param defaults included), so a firing 2304 means the binding truly appears nowhere; the existing "Remove unused import" quickfix applies unchanged.
  • License: from this release the extensions ship under the ReactiveUI Community License 1.0 (previously PolyForm Shield 1.0.0) — free to use and to ship commercially for any company under US $250,000 trailing-12-month revenue; above that, shipping a product needs a commercial license ($2,000 per title or $2,500 per studio per year — LICENSE-COMMERCIAL.md in the repo). No functional changes: the VS Code extension's bundled LICENSE carries the new text, and the VS2022 VSIX now ships a LICENSE.txt (it previously carried no license file at all). Every previously published extension version keeps the license it shipped with.

[0.6.0] - 2026-07-18

  • Workspace language features land: find-all-references (tags, code references, import/export tokens — close tags included), rename with the family's ES semantics (renaming a declaration updates every importer including A as B target spellings; renaming a local alias stays in the importer; renaming a plain imported binding inserts A as NewName so the export is untouched — invalid names, collisions and host-tag shadowing refuse with a reason), document + workspace symbols, and four quickfixes: add the missing import (UETKX2305), remove the unused import (UETKX2304), add export in the TARGET file (UETKX2301), and migrate a deprecated wrapper to the plain declaration form (UETKX2320 — byte-identical to the codemod's rewrite). Reference analysis is scope-aware: a local variable shadowing an exported name is never miscounted as a symbol reference.
  • Embedded-C++ locals rename too: a cursor on a body local forwards the rename to clangd over the virtual document and translates the edits back into your .uetkx — all-or-nothing by design (an engine-header symbol, an occurrence in generated glue, or a block whose C++ has unresolved errors refuses with a reason instead of applying a partial rename). Works without a compile database for UE's numeric types; engine types need one (the refusal says so).
  • Audit hardening for the new workspace features: a setup local used inside a markup expression is no longer a phantom reference (a rename could edit user code it must not touch); range-for variables and lambda parameters count as locals; a plain-binding rename now validates only the importer it edits (no more spurious refusals when the new alias exists elsewhere); removing an unused MULTI-LINE import deletes the whole statement instead of leaving a dangling } from; comments inside an import { … } name list parse correctly (they already did in the compiler); and reference resolution compares paths case-insensitively on Windows so a mis-cased specifier can't silently drop an importer from a rename.
